Safe-Guard Canine Dewormer is a highly effective treatment designed specifically for small dogs, targeting common intestinal parasites like tapeworms, roundworms, hookworms, and whipworms. This easy-to-feed granule formula is safe for puppies over 6 weeks old, pregnant dogs, and those with heartworm, ensuring a worry-free deworming experience. Each package contains three 1-gram pouches, providing a complete 3-day treatment that offers protection for up to 6 months.

Easiest wormer I have ever used - didn't make my pup sick!
I was a bit worried that the powder option wouldn't work for my pup. I thought he would smell it or taste it and refuse to eat it on his food. I was also concerned that I would have a MESS (you know what I mean if you make sure to worm your dog) for the 3 day treatment. I was wrong on every level.I simply placed my pup's food in his bowl as usual, emptied the powder for that day on top, added a little water and mixed it up. He did fine with it! I'm not sure how this would go if you free feed your dog instead of having scheduled feeding times. I would say maybe for the 3 day treatment take the food up and schedule feed for those 3 days to be sure they get their entire dose. I gave it to my boy first thing every morning in case it made him sick. I didn't want to be up all night cleaning messes.This DID NOT make him sick in any way. This was the easiest multi-wormer I have ever used. He didn't act like he didn't feel well or like he didn't have much energy. It was business as usual! This was a preventative treatment for us. I have a friend whose dog had tapeworms that my pup had recently played with so I was worried he may have gotten them. I did check his poop to be sure nothing was there. He was clean... no worms or evidence of worms.I will use this product again for all of my dogs. Make sure you do check your dog's weight before you purchase so you get the right amount for dosage.
